Comment(by macports@…):
This is definitely not fixed. I tried from scratch - downloading
MacPorts-1.7.0-10.5-Leopard.dmg, and then doing "sudo port install
gnucash". Once I start gnucash, I get:
Xlib: extension "RANDR" missing on display "/tmp/launch-lVQBbc/:0".
Followed by the complaint that preferences are not accessible.
Then I get a bunch of:
Failed to load key /apps/gnucash/general/show_splash_screen: Failed to
contact configuration server; some possible causes are that you need to
enable TCP/IP networking for ORBit, or you have stale NFS locks due to a
system crash. See http://www.gnome.org/projects/gconf/ for information.
(Details - 1: Failed to get connection to session: dbus-launch failed to
autolaunch D-Bus session: EOF in dbus-launch reading address from bus
daemon
If I try
dbus-launch gnucash
I get:
Failed to start message bus: In D-Bus address, character '+' should have
been escaped
EOF in dbus-launch reading address from bus daemon
